Ajanta and Ellora caves, Aurangabad
These caves truly reflect the all accommodating nature of the ancient civilization of India. These caves contain well proportioned decorated paintings and sculptures which are widely regarded as master pieces of Buddhist religious art. Ellora caves feature a chaitya hall with a beautiful image of a Buddha set on a stupa
Srinagar
The summer capital of the Indian state of Jammu and Kashmir, Srinagar hosts Asia’s largest tulip garden. The abundance of lakes and gardens has resulted in it being labeled the ‘City of lakes and Gardens’. The fully frozen dal lake in winters in winters is a sight to behold in itself.
Kerela
The state of Kerala is also known as ‘God’s own Country’ for its natural beauty. Beautiful beaches dotted with resorts offering complete ayurvedic and yoga packages will refresh your mind and soul and bring you closer than ever. The house boat ride in the romantic backwaters is likely to be the most unforgettable romantic experience.

Taj Mahal, Agra
Built on the banks of the Yamuna, it is a mausoleum built of pure white marble. A UNESCO world heritage site, the tomb, minarets, side pishtaqs (doors) and the majestic gateway all adorn this marvelous piece of architecture. A high boundary wall having broad octagonal pavilions encloses the whole structure. The calligraphies and paintings on the external structure provide the finest examples of mughal style architecture.
Corbett national park, Uttrakhand
Spread over an area of around 1300 square meters, this is one of the largest national parks in India. Apart from teeming with wild life like nilgai ,sloth bear ,wild boar, python ,monitor lizard, kingfishers etc,it is home to more than 600 varieties of trees ,shrubs and grasses
Leh
Situated at an altitude of more than 3500 kilometers, Leh is also known as the roof of the world. This place is one of the finest examples of the Buddhist traditions of India. Numerous monasteries, sculpture and stupas dot the landscape of Leh. Also popular is the museum in Leh palace featuring rich collections of crowns and jewelley.
Mahabodhi temple complex, Bihar
Known as the great awakening temple, the pure brick construction dates back to the third century BC.One of the four holy sites of Buddhism, this is the place where Lord Buddha attained enlightenment.
Sun temple, Konark
As the name suggests this temple is all about the power of the surya devta or the sun god. A huge chariot drawn by seven horses and twelve pairs of beautifully carved wheels reflect the significance which ancient civilizations placed on the power of the sun. Beautifully and geometrically carved out figures of animals and humans give this place a distinctive look and feel
Sanchi
Sanchi is an UNESCO world heritage site with numerous Buddhist temples, pillars and monasteries dating back to the seventh and eighth century.
